What is Eagle Graphite Interest Coverage?

Interest Coverage is a ratio that determines how easily a company can pay interest expenses on outstanding debt. It is calculated by dividing a company's Operating Income by its Interest Expense. Eagle Graphite's Operating Income for the three months ended in Feb. 2022 was $-0.10 Mil. Eagle Graphite's Interest Expense for the three months ended in Feb. 2022 was $-0.04 Mil. did not have earnings to cover the interest expense. The higher the ratio, the stronger the company's financial strength is.

Eagle Graphite Interest Coverage Calculation

Interest Coverage is a ratio that determines how easily a company can pay interest expenses on outstanding debt. It is calculated by dividing a company's Operating Income (EBIT) by its Interest Expense:

If Interest Expense is negative and Operating Income is positive, then

Interest Coverage=-1* Operating Income /Interest Expense

Else if Interest Expense is negative and Operating Income is negative, then

The company did not have earnings to cover the interest expense.

Else if Interest Expense is 0 and Long-Term Debt & Capital Lease Obligation is 0, then

The company had no debt (1).


Note: If both Interest Expense and Interest Income are empty, while Net Interest Income is negative, then use Net Interest Income as Interest Expense.

Eagle Graphite's Interest Coverage for the fiscal year that ended in May. 2021 is calculated as

Here, for the fiscal year that ended in May. 2021, Eagle Graphite's Interest Expense was $-0.22 Mil. Its Operating Income was $0.03 Mil. And its Long-Term Debt & Capital Lease Obligation was $0.05 Mil.

Interest Coverage=-1* Operating Income (A: May. 2021 )/Interest Expense (A: May. 2021 )
=-1*0.029/-0.219
=0.13

Eagle Graphite  (OTCPK:APMFF) Interest Coverage Explanation

Ben Graham requires that a company has a minimum interest coverage of 5 with the companies he invested. If the interest coverage is less than 2, the company is burdened by debt. Any business slow or recession may drag the company into a situation where it cannot pay the interest on its debt.

Interest Coverage is an important factor when GuruFocus ranks a company's overage Financial Strength .

Eagle Graphite Inc is a junior exploration-stage company. Principally, the company is engaged in the business of graphite exploration and evaluation in British Columbia, Canada. Its project includes Black crystal project located in the Slocan Valley area of British Columbia, approximately 35 kilometers west of the city of Nelson, and approximately 70 kilometers north of the border to the United States of America. The projects main activities comprise of graphite quarry and processing plant.
